Originally Posted by feline fanatic View Post
What a great quilt. And kudos to you on that border. I get blurry eyed just looking at the optical illusion of it, however you could not have picked a more perfect fabric for it. Can't imagine what it was like mitering the corners on that bad boy.
Well, one border was 1/4" too long - sooooo, I took the border and sewed two of the tiny stripes in the op-art border together. The border finished out the perfect size.

Originally Posted by kountrykreation View Post
Absolutely love it (and the one in your avatar as well)!
Both patterns are my own - I've posted a tutorial on the Op-Art. The avatar quilt was drafted to look like an 1830 quilt in the Univ. Neb. Lincoln quilt collection - I worked from a photo (with permission) about 3" square.
